Discover the city that never sleeps with this immersive experience. It's the perfect way to see the best sights and sounds of the Big Apple. With a 360-degree view from the top of the bus, you'll enjoy stunning views of iconic landmarks such as the Empire State Building, the Statue of Liberty, and the Brooklyn Bridge. Let our live guide share fascinating insights into the city's history and culture with you, as well as insider tips for the best places to eat, shop, and explore. As the sun sets over New York City, experience a new perspective of “The City That Never Sleeps.” See the bright lights of Times Square, then head downtown toward the illuminated Empire State Building and historic Flatiron Building. Cross the Manhattan Bridge for eye-popping views of the city skyline, great for photo ops! Finish the tour heading up the Avenue of the Americas with views of Macy’s Department Store and Radio City Music Hall. You haven’t seen the Big Apple until you’ve seen it at night!

Q: Is this tour suitable for kids? What age range is best?

A: Yes, this tour is great for kids! There’s no strict age limit, so families with children tend to enjoy it a lot. Just keep in mind that it lasts about 2 hours, and it can get a bit chilly at night, so bring a light jacket for the little ones. The sights and sounds are pretty captivating for all ages, especially the lights in Times Square!

Q: What should we wear for the night tour? Is it cold up there?

A: Dress in layers! It can get chilly at night, especially on the top deck of the bus. A light jacket or sweater is recommended. Also, comfy shoes are a must, since you'll be standing and moving around a bit for photos. The view is worth the slight chill!

Q: How's the parking situation for the tour? Any tips on getting there?

A: Parking in NYC can be a nightmare! If you’re driving, I suggest using a parking app to find a garage nearby. Otherwise, public transport is a great option. The tour starts around Times Square, which is super accessible by subway. Definitely plan to arrive a bit early to find a good spot!
